Commands Page
You can move tapes, run a system inventory, reset the picker to its home
position, or perform sequential operations from the
Commands
page.
When you click
Commands
, the page displays.
From a remote location, you can request that a tape be moved from one
position to another. To move a tape:
1
From any page, click the
Commands
heading. The
Commands
screen
displays.
2
From the
Moving Tapes
section of the page, click the drop-down
menu under
From:
and select the current location of the tape that you
want to move.
3
From the drop-down menu
under
To:
, select the location to which
you want to move the tape, and then click
submit
.
Inventory
4
The autoloader automatically runs an inventory whenever you power it
on or insert a magazine. If you need to run an inventory in addition to
this, you can use On-board Remote Management to do it remotely. To
run an inventory:
1
From any page, click the
Commands
heading. The
Commands
screen
displays.
2
From the
Commands
page, click
Inventory
. The autoloader starts an
inventory immediately.
Set to Home
4
If the autoloader is not able to successfully execute a
Moving Tapes
or an
Inventory
command, try executing a
Set to Home
command, and then
retry the move or inventory command again.
The
Set to Home
command resets the autoloader as a means to help the
autoloader recover from an unexpected internal condition. To set to
